Sec. 10-103(a)(3)(A) B) The builder shall provide the building owner, manager, and the original occupants the appropriate Certificate(s) of Compliance and a list of the features, materials, components, and mechanical devices installed In the building, and instructions on how to use them efficiently. Sec. 10-103(b)(1) C) After installing wall, ceiling, or floor insulation, the installer shall post in a conspicuous location in the building a certificated signed by the installer stating that the installation Is consistent with the plans and requirement of section 10-103(a) (2) (A) and conforms with the requirements of part 6. The certificate shall also state the manufacturer's name and material identification and the installed R-value. Sec. 150(m) L) All fan systems exhausting air from the building to the outside shall be provided with backdraft. or automatic dampers to prevent air leakage. Sec. 150(m)7 M) Storage gas water heaters with an energy factor<0.58 shall be having installed thermal resistance externally wrapped with insulation haV of R-12 or greater. Sec. 150(j)1 A N) Unfired hot water tanks, such as storage tanks and backup storage tanks for solar water heating systems, shall be externally wrapped with insulation having an installed thermal resistance of R-12 or greater or have internal insulation of at least R-16 and a label on the exterior of the tank showing the insulation R-value. Sec. 150(j)l B aerosol 0) Duct system opening shall be sealed with mastic, tape sealant, or other duct closure system that meets the applicable requirement of UL 181A, or UL181B including collars, connections and splices.
